From the reviews:
“The book describes convex optimization techniques to deal with stability and performance evaluation for linear dynamical systems subject to parametric uncertainty. … In summary, the book is a welcome and timely addition to the technical literature, written by leading experts in the field. It is aimed at systems and control researchers willing to explore further than mainstream LMI Lyapunov analysis techniques, with the possibility of trading off between conservatism and computational burden.” (Didier Henrion, Mathematical Reviews, Issue 2010 g)Homogeneous Polynomial Forms for Robustness Analysis of Uncertain Systems
